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
528 44725536253 2921780 5612904
6665 3425393977
6665 3425393977
378876 59675199 43802050 6615 78563238
All about undefined
Interested in learning more?
6665 3425393977
378876 59675199 43802050 6615 78563238
See more
9213 36179834660
16307956662 531740 759
See more
981600972 4177922
54799067 145 8111
See more